PASADENA - As the 10th anniversary of 9/11 approaches, the City Council will be asked to weigh in tonight on long-standing plans to designate New York Drive between Sierra Madre Boulevard and Altadena Drive as Pasadena's memorial to the worst terrorist attack on U.S. soil.
